A conference convened later in the session to consider SB1365 (HD1), which would implement the interstate medical licensure compact.
Senate conferees said a proposed CD1 would include House technical amendments and a corrected effective date. They reported that the relevant department had advised a $25,000 appropriation ceiling had been included in the budget. Because the draft was received only moments earlier, conferees agreed to roll the item to April 22 at 1:40 p.m. in Room 224 so members could review the draft and confirm fiscal and technical details.
The brief session did not include a vote; the conference will reconvene to consider the finalized CD1.
